프론트엔드 팀에서 멋진 사용자 인터페이스를 구축할 준비가 되었습니다. 디자인은 승인되었고, 구성 요소도 계획되었지만 한 가지 문제가 있습니다. 바로 백엔드 API가 아직 존재하지 않는다는 것입니다. 아니면 존재하더라도 불안정하거나 불완전하거나 끊임없이 변경됩니다. 당신은 의존성 지옥에 갇혀 실질적인 진전을 이루지 못하고 있습니다.
한편, 백엔드 팀은 데이터베이스 스키마, 인증 로직, 성능 최적화 등으로 바쁘게 일하고 있습니다. 그들은 API가 "곧" 준비될 것이라고 약속하지만, 개발 시간에서 "곧"은 영원처럼 느껴질 수 있습니다.
이러한 답답한 시나리오는 과거에는 시간 낭비와 프로젝트 지연을 의미했습니다. 하지만 오늘날에는 두 팀 모두 독립적으로 계속 나아갈 수 있게 해주는 훌륭한 해결책이 있습니다. 바로 협업 기능을 갖춘 API 모의(Mocking)입니다.
올바른 모의 서비스는 가짜 엔드포인트를 생성하는 것 이상입니다. 이는 프론트엔드와 백엔드 팀이 계약에 동의하고, 동시에 개발하며, 문제를 조기에 발견할 수 있는 협업 공간이 됩니다. 그리고 가장 좋은 점은 무엇일까요? 이러한 강력한 도구 중 다수는 팀이 시작하기에 완벽한 강력한 무료 요금제를 제공한다는 것입니다.
이제 무료 협업 API 모의 서비스의 세계와 이것이 개발 워크플로우를 어떻게 변화시킬 수 있는지 살펴보겠습니다.
모의 서비스가 "협업적"이게 만드는 것은 무엇일까요?
도구를 평가할 때 다음 핵심 협업 기능을 찾아보세요:
- 공유 작업 공간: 팀원들이 동일한 모의 API에 접근하고 작업할 수 있는 중앙 집중식 공간입니다.
- 역할 기반 접근 제어: 모의 API를 보고, 편집하고, 관리할 수 있는 사람을 관리하는 기능입니다.
- 댓글 및 토론: API 사양에 직접 엔드포인트, 응답 및 변경 사항을 논의할 수 있는 내장된 방법입니다.
- 버전 기록 및 변경 추적: 누가, 언제 무엇을 변경했는지 확인하고 필요한 경우 되돌릴 수 있는 기능입니다.
- 실시간 업데이트: 누군가 모의를 업데이트하면 모든 사람이 변경 사항을 즉시 확인합니다.
- 디자인 도구와의 통합: API 디자인을 즉시 모의 서버로 전환하는 기능입니다.
협업 기능을 갖춘 최고의 무료 API 모의 서비스
이제 협업 기능을 제공하는 무료 요금제를 가진 몇 가지 인기 있는 옵션을 비교해 보겠습니다.
1. Apidog: 올인원 API 협업 플랫폼

Apidog는 전체 API 워크플로우인 API 디자인, 모의, 테스트, 디버깅, 문서화를 단일 협업 플랫폼에 통합하여 돋보입니다.
주요 협업 기능 (무료 요금제):
- 팀 작업 공간: 팀원들이 협업할 수 있는 공유 프로젝트를 생성합니다.
- 실시간 협업: 여러 팀원이 동일한 API 디자인에서 동시에 작업할 수 있습니다.
- 역할 기반 권한: 뷰어, 편집자, 관리자의 접근을 관리합니다.
- 댓글 시스템: 플랫폼 내에서 직접 API에 대해 논의합니다.
- 버전 제어: API 디자인 및 모의에 대한 변경 사항을 추적합니다.
- 즉석 모의 서버: 한 번의 클릭으로 API 디자인에서 모의 서버를 생성합니다.
작동 방식:
- Apidog의 시각적 편집기에서 API 엔드포인트를 디자인합니다.
- "모의 서버 생성"을 클릭하면 즉시 URL이 생성됩니다.
- 프론트엔드 팀과 프로젝트를 공유합니다. 그들은 디자인, 문서화를 보고 모의 URL을 사용할 수 있습니다.
- 백엔드 팀은 동일한 디자인을 구현 청사진으로 사용할 수 있습니다.
- 디자인이 발전함에 따라 모든 사람이 동기화 상태를 유지합니다.
가장 적합한 대상: 강력한 협업 기능이 통합된 전체 API 수명 주기를 다루는 통합 솔루션을 원하는 팀입니다.
팀이 좋아하는 Apidog의 협업 기능
특히 협업에 대해 자세히 살펴보겠습니다.
- 공유 프로젝트: 모든 사람이 동일한 API 프로젝트에서 작업하여 중복을 피합니다.
- 환경 기반 모의: 서로 다른 팀이 충돌 없이 서로 다른 환경에서 테스트할 수 있습니다.
- 실시간 업데이트: API 정의가 변경되면 모의가 즉시 업데이트됩니다.
- 클라우드 모의 및 자체 호스팅 모의 옵션: 팀은 모의 서버를 실행할 위치를 선택할 수 있으며, 이는 보안에 민감한 조직에 특히 유용합니다.
이러한 기능은 Apidog를 분산 및 원격 팀에 강력한 선택으로 만듭니다.
2. Postman: 모의 서버를 갖춘 API 거인
Postman은 API 분야의 베테랑이며, 무료 요금제에는 강력한 모의 기능이 포함되어 있습니다.
주요 협업 기능 (무료 요금제):
- 공유 작업 공간: 무료 플랜에서는 3명으로 제한됩니다.
- 댓글: 팀원들이 컬렉션과 요청에 댓글을 달 수 있습니다.
- 컬렉션 공유: 링크를 통해 모의 컬렉션을 쉽게 공유할 수 있습니다.
- 내장 모의 서버: 컬렉션에서 직접 모의 서버를 생성합니다.
- 팀 라이브러리: 환경 및 변수와 같은 공통 요소를 공유합니다.
무료 요금제 제한:
- 작업 공간당 3명의 협업자만 가능
- 제한된 모의 서버 호출 (월 1000회)
- 제한된 기록 보존
가장 적합한 대상: 테스트를 위해 이미 Postman 생태계에 투자한 소규모 팀입니다.
3. Mockoon: 오픈 소스 데스크톱 옵션
Mockoon은 사용량 제한 없이 완전히 무료인 환상적인 오픈 소스 데스크톱 애플리케이션입니다.
주요 협업 기능:
- 가져오기/내보내기: JSON 파일을 통해 모의 구성을 공유합니다.
- Git 통합: 모의 설정을 버전 제어에 저장합니다.
- 다중 환경: 다양한 시나리오에 대해 다른 응답 세트를 생성합니다.
- 템플릿 공유: 팀과 모의 템플릿을 생성하고 공유합니다.
협업 제한:
- 내장된 실시간 협업 기능 없음 – 파일 공유/Git에 의존
- 팀을 위한 중앙 집중식 웹 인터페이스 없음
- 사용자 관리 또는 권한 시스템 없음
가장 적합한 대상: 오픈 소스 도구를 선호하고 Git 및 파일 공유를 통해 협업을 관리하는 데 개의치 않는 개발자입니다.
4. Stoplight Studio: 디자인 우선 협업
Stoplight는 시각적 API 디자인 도구를 사용하여 디자인 우선 접근 방식에 중점을 둡니다.
주요 협업 기능 (무료 요금제):
- 공유 작업 공간: API 디자인에 대해 협업합니다.
- 스타일 가이드 및 린팅: 팀 전체에 걸쳐 API 디자인 표준을 적용합니다.
- 시각적 API 디자이너: OpenAPI 사양을 시각적으로 생성합니다.
- 모의: OpenAPI 사양에서 모의를 자동 생성합니다.
- 댓글 및 검토: 내장된 검토 워크플로우입니다.
무료 요금제 제한:
- 1개 프로젝트로 제한
- 기본 모의 기능
- 일부 고급 협업 기능은 유료 플랜이 필요합니다.
가장 적합한 대상: OpenAPI를 사용하여 엄격한 디자인 우선 방법론을 따르는 팀입니다.
5. WireMock: 개발자 중심 옵션
WireMock은 독립형 서버로 실행할 수 있는 강력한 오픈 소스 모의 라이브러리입니다.
주요 협업 기능:
- Git 통합: 모의 정의를 버전 제어에 코드 형태로 저장합니다.
- JSON 구성: JSON 파일을 통해 모의 설정을 공유하고 협업합니다.
- 광범위한 프로그래밍: 복잡한 응답 로직을 프로그래밍 방식으로 생성합니다.
- 자체 호스팅: 모의 인프라에 대한 완전한 제어.
협업 접근 방식:
WireMock에는 내장된 협업 UI가 없습니다. 대신 팀은 다음을 통해 협업합니다:
- 모의 정의에 대한 코드 검토
- 공유 Docker 이미지 또는 Helm 차트
- 모의 API 문서화
가장 적합한 대상: 코드 기반 구성에 익숙하며 최대한의 유연성과 제어를 원하는 개발 팀입니다.
결론: 함께 모의하고, 더 잘 만드세요
개발자들이 의존성이 준비될 때까지 기다리며 놀고 있던 시대는 지났습니다. 협업 기능을 갖춘 최신 API 모의는 팀이 병렬로 작업하고, 정렬을 유지하며, 더 높은 품질의 소프트웨어를 더 빠르게 제공할 수 있도록 합니다.
핵심 통찰력은 모의가 고립된 활동이 되어서는 안 된다는 것입니다. 이는 프론트엔드, 백엔드, QA 및 제품 팀을 API 계약에 대한 공유된 이해를 중심으로 모이게 하는 협업 프로세스여야 합니다.
올인원 접근 방식 때문에 Apidog를 선택하든, 생태계 때문에 Postman을 선택하든, 단순성 때문에 Mockoon을 선택하든, 중요한 것은 개발 프로세스 초기에 API를 중심으로 협업을 시작하는 것입니다.
최고의 API는 단순히 기술적으로 건전한 것만이 아닙니다. 그것은 그것을 사용할 모든 사람의 의견을 수렴하여 협력적으로 구축된 것입니다. 그리고 오늘날의 무료 협업 모의 도구를 사용하면 오늘부터 더 나은 API를 함께 구축하지 않을 이유가 없습니다.
